Post by Normi on Jan 16, 2020 19:11:01 GMT -5
Album out (in my region at least), Sad Tonight is treated as the lead single (is she finally trying her luck on Pop radio??)
Track list: 1. Sad Tonight 2. Strangers Again 3. What Would It Take 4. I Was In Heaven 5. Are You Listening 6. nj 7. Somebody Else Will Get Your Eyes 8. You Are Losing Me 9. I Miss You 10. The Human Condition 11. Lucky ft. Alexander 23 12. I Should Let You Go 13. How To Be Human 14. New Recordings 28 - Lions 15. Crazier Things
